India experiences extreme heat waves as temperatures rise above 50 degrees Celsius.

Reported 4 months ago

The temperature in India has reached nearly 50 degrees Celsius, just shy of the all-time high, as deadly heat waves across the country pose serious health risks. The city of Churu in Rajasthan recorded a temperature of 50.5 degrees Celsius, close to the record of 51 degrees set in 2016. Climate change has worsened extreme weather events in India, with rising temperatures impacting lives, power grids, and agriculture. Authorities are advising people to take precautions, as cases of heat stroke and deaths have been reported, although the government has not confirmed the numbers.
